Tessa is the main antagonist of the 2025 science fiction action film Predator: Badlands, the ninth installment of the Predator franchise.
In her characterisation, she is an advanced synthetic created by the Weyland-Yutani Corp, along with Thia, who she later regards as her twin sister; the pair were originally sent to Genna on an operation to capture the Kalisk, but were separated when the Kalisk attacked. After being repaired and learning that Thia had paired with a Yautja known as Dek, Tessa sought out to complete the mission once more.
She was portrayed by Elle Fanning (in her first villain role), who also played Thia in the same film.
Appearance[]
Tessa almost looks identical to Thia, she wore a white suit but later wore a black suit; her blonde hair is lighter, seeming essentially white. Despite her repair after being damaged by the Kalisk, her right eye remained milky white.
Personality[]
Tessa is cold and calculating with no regard for any life nor even her fellow synths. She only cares about fulfilling the orders given by the Company. She is a firm believer in Darwinism, rather in an extreme version that makes her feel contempt for any life she deems as too weak to be allowed to live; she also believes that might makes right.
Biography[]
Background[]
Built by the Weyland-Yutani Corp, Tessa along with Thia and a group of synths, were sent to Genna with orders to capture the Kalisk and send it to the company but were nearly all but destroyed in the attempt with Tessa and Thia being seprated after.
Predator: Badlands[]
Having been brought back to the main base in Genna, Tessa was repaired by MOTHER, who informed Tessa about a Yautja who had arrived to claim the Kalisk as its kill and gives Tessa additional orders to capture the Yautja and bring its advanced weapons to the company.
Entering Genna's wildlife accompanied by synth soldiers, Tessa find the Yautja's crashed ship and manages to retrive the weapons before being alerted to Thia's location. Arriving, Tessa finds the Yautja Dek being overpowered by the Kalisk, giving Tessa the opportunity to use a cryogenic grenade to freeze the two in place and retrieves Thia.
After loading the Kalisk and restraining Dek, Tess learns that Dex is a runt who seeks to kill the Kalisk in order to rejoin his clan. Tess then proceeded to torture Dek on how to work his weapons despite Thia's pleads. Tess calls Thia a defective synth and orders her body to be destroyed when they leave. Tess then leaves the room placing a synth guard in charge who is quickly destoyed after Thia tricks him into activating a Yautja toy as Thia helps Dex escape befrore being locked in a storage container.
Tess and the synths then begin to load the Kalisk and Thia onto a shuttle, but are interrupted by the return of Dex along with the baby Kalisk Bud. Dek then destroys most of the synth gaurds while Thia escapes and helps Bud rescue the Kalisk, who is also Bud's mother. Taking matters into her own hands, Tess arms herself with a plasma caster and uses a mech to fight Dek before fighting off the Kalisk, who then eats her whole.
Seemingly dead, Dex and Thia return Bud to the Kalisk who then explodes after Tess uses cryo grenades and the plasma caster from inside her body, resulting in her being heavily damaged. Tess then attemps to kill Thia with the plasma caster, only to get her spine and skull torn out by Bud before Dex claims her remains as his kill trophy.
Trivia[]
- Tessa serves as a foil to Kwei, Dek's older brother. Thia looks up to her as a surrogate older sibling figure in a similar manner Dek looks up to Kwei, and Tessa sacrificed both her duty and her wellbeing to ensure Thia's survival in the much the same way Kwei did for Dek. However, their roles rapidly diverge from there, as Tessa after being rebooted comes to regard her love for her sister as a weakness, and consciously chooses to suppress it. Ironically, she ends up representing the Yautjia's society ideals the best, discarding her own sister when she proves too much of a hassle, while Kwei saves his brother at the cost of his life at the hands of Njohrr.
